The term "tweener" gets thrown around too often, but it fits Halischuk pretty well. He's not talented enough to play in a scoring role, and he's woeful at chance prevention in a checking line role. Putting him on any line almost guarantees that line spends most of their time in the defensive zone.

I actually wouldn't be surprised if Halischuk ends up being like Spencer Machacek was a few years ago. I just really, really, really hope he doesn't get penciled in to a third line role at the start of the year.
